In the realm of blockchain technology, a single platform consistently stands out: Ethereum. Far beyond a cryptocurrency, Ethereum is a distributed worldwide network that has radically transformed our understanding of digital interaction, finance, and ownership. Launched in 2015 by a group of developers including the prolific Vitalik Buterin, its core innovation was the implementation of the smart contract. This powerful concept propelled the blockchain from a simple ledger for payments into a broad platform for programmable, trustless applications.
At its heart, Ethereum is a public, accessible network powered by thousands of independent computers around the globe. These nodes collectively work together to maintain and secure a shared database known as the Ethereum Virtual Machine (EVM). This EVM is the operating system for smart contracts, which are basically pieces of code that run by themselves once specific conditions are met. Unlike traditional contracts, they require no intermediary, lawyer, or central authority to carry them out. The agreements are coded directly into the software and are unchangeable once deployed, guaranteeing transparent and secure outcomes.
This seemingly simple concept has opened a astonishing range of possibilities. The most prominent application is DeFi, a whole alternative financial system built on Ethereum. Within DeFi, users can borrow and lend assets, trade tokens, earn interest, and utilize sophisticated financial instruments all directly without banks or brokers. A further world-changing use case is NFTs, unique digital certificates that prove ownership of digital (and sometimes physical) items. From digital art and collectibles to music and virtual real estate, NFTs have created new markets for creators and collectors equally.
Furthermore, Ethereum enables decentralized autonomous organizations, which are member-owned communities controlled completely by smart contracts and the votes of their token holders. DAOs embody a new model for collective organization, funding, and decision-making, free from hierarchical management. The network also serves as the foundation for countless other applications, including play-to-earn games, social networks, logistics solutions, and secure voting systems. Put simply, if a process can benefit from transparency, security, and automation, it can likely be built on Ethereum.
The native currency that powers this entire ecosystem is called Ether (ETH). Ether is much more than just a cryptocurrency to be traded. It is the lifeblood of the network, required to compensate computation. Every operation, from a basic transaction to a complex smart contract, needs a fee known as "gas," which is paid in ETH. This gas fee incentivizes node operators (or validators) to process and secure transactions. Users also "stake" their ETH as a kind of collateral to become validators themselves, helping to secure the network and gaining yields in return.
Historically, Ethereum ran on a system called proof-of-work, much like Bitcoin. However in September 2022, the network completed a monumental upgrade known as "The Merge." This event shifted Ethereum to a proof-of-stake consensus model, drastically reducing its energy consumption by over 99.9%. This upgrade was not the final step, but a crucial part of a larger roadmap to increase its capacity and improve its performance. Future upgrades centered on "sharding" and layer-2 rollups are designed to greatly boost transaction speed and lower fees, making the network cheaper to use for billions of users.
Naturally, Ethereum faces substantial hurdles. Network congestion has in the past led to expensive gas fees, although layer-2 solutions are actively addressing this issue. The regulatory landscape is uncertain in many jurisdictions, particularly regarding the classification of ETH and the tokens built upon it. Additionally, it faces intense competition from alternative blockchain platforms that promise higher speeds or lower costs. However, Ethereum's formidable strengths its pioneering position, exceptional security, huge community of builders, and profound network effects make it an extremely resilient and flexible platform.
